Windy City Toolbank Inc

Fiscal year ending 2024. Filed on November 12, 2025.

1100 W Cermak Road Ste 127
Chicago, Illinois 60608

Windy City Toolbank Inc (EIN: 84-3929137) has filed an IRS Form 990 since fiscal year 2022. In its fiscal year 2024 IRS Form 990 filing, Windy City Toolbank Inc, a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 9 employ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$0.
